HTML5(简称H5)作为新一代网页标准,正在彻底改变网站开发的方式。相比传统HTML,H5提供了更丰富的多媒体支持、更流畅的动画效果和更强大的跨平台兼容性,使其成为创建现代网站的首选技术。
1. 响应式设计:自动适配各种屏幕尺寸,从手机到桌面设备都能完美显示
2. 多媒体支持:原生支持视频、音频等多媒体元素,无需插件
3. 离线功能:通过应用缓存实现离线访问能力
4. 性能优化:更简洁的代码结构和更快的加载速度
H5引入了header、footer、article等语义化标签,使代码结构更清晰,同时提升SEO效果。
通过Canvas API可以实现复杂的图形绘制和动画效果,为网站增添视觉吸引力。
LocalStorage和SessionStorage提供了比cookie更强大的客户端数据存储方案。
1. 需求分析与规划:明确网站目标和功能需求
2. 原型设计:创建网站结构和界面布局
3. 前端开发:使用H5+CSS3+JavaScript实现页面
4. 测试与优化:确保跨平台兼容性和性能表现
5. 部署上线:将网站发布到服务器
随着WebAssembly、PWA等新技术的成熟,H5网站将具备更接近原生应用的体验。人工智能与H5的结合也将为网站开发带来更多可能性,如智能内容推荐、语音交互等功能将成为标配。
对于初学者,可以从学习基础的HTML5标签和CSS3样式开始。有经验的开发者可以探索更高级的H5 API和框架,如React、Vue等现代前端框架都能很好地支持H5开发。